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

When selecting a head unit for a pickup, several factors shape the best overall choice for your needs:

  • Fit and installation: Confirm dash compatibility (single vs. double DIN, mounting kits, wiring harnesses) for your specific truck model and year. Some units include adaptability for Dodge Ram, Silverado, and GMC lines, which simplifies installation.
  • Interface and controls: If you rely on Apple CarPlay or Android Auto, prioritize wireless integration and voice control responsiveness. A bright, angled touch screen with good daylight visibility improves usability on the road.
  • Navigation and maps: Look for built‑in GPS with offline maps or reliable online map access. WiFi connectivity is a plus for updating apps and downloading services.
  • Audio processing: A capable DSP, EQ bands, and preamp outputs matter if you plan to add amps or subwoofers. Consider whether you want louder bass or a polished, studio‑like soundstage.
  • Connectivity: Evaluate Bluetooth support, USB availability, and compatibility with steering wheel controls. Wireless CarPlay/Android Auto can reduce cable clutter and improve safety.
  • Media features: DVD/CD players are rare in modern head units, but some options still include CD/DVD playback. Decide if optical discs are important for you.
  • Updates and support: Check for ongoing software updates, app availability, and customer support quality. A well‑supported system reduces long‑term headaches.

Depth of features versus price is a common trade‑off. If you want top‑tier sound, a robust multimedia experience, and strong navigation, consider models with built‑in DSP and multi‑channel amplifiers. If simplicity and budget are priorities, a unit with essential CarPlay/Android Auto and a responsive touchscreen may be more appropriate. Always verify the exact vehicle year, trim, and dash layout before purchasing to ensure a proper fit.
